Well Gilda I guess I was forced into doing it right partly when I got remarried. I had to move, a 980 sq ft house wasn't going to "get it" with 8 people, now 9 in the family:D As a fact, the GH was almost the same size as my house! The old location was too shady for the Phrags. One out of a dozen might of bloomed in the 5 year period I lived there. Now I've bloomed 10 out the 2 dozen I have. Plus I increased the concentration of the fertizer from 100ppm to 150 of N.
